Job Overview

As an Analytics and Insights Designer at Disney, you will be responsible for building frameworks for data collection, maintaining a platform that supports data storage, processing, and retrieval, and assembling and evaluating consumer requirements for accurate and best-fit solutions. You will also work with stakeholders to gather clear requirements, join data from multiple sources to deliver ideal results, and identify potential opportunities to impact product outcomes.

Responsibilities

  • Build frameworks for data collection and maintain a platform that supports data storage, processing, and retrieval
  • Assemble and evaluate consumer requirements for accurate and best-fit solutions
  • Join data from multiple sources to deliver ideal results for management reporting, executive dashboards, or KPIs
  • Work with stakeholders to gather clear requirements and identify potential opportunities to impact product outcomes
  • Define and document relevant process improvement opportunities
  • Utilize complex tools/projects to mine data sources and apply data engineering skills to develop more advanced solutions

Requirements

  • At least 10 years of experience working in Data Technology
  • Master-level expertise with Azure Data Factory, Snowflake, and data brick
  • Design background and additional skills and knowledge in data security
  • Experience with automation technologies and writing complex scripts using SQL or Python
  • Solid experience with Management domains and cycles
  • Proven expertise with Business Intelligence methods and tools - Tableau Server, Service Now, and Business Objects

Key Skills

  • Ability to recognize and interpret data in the context of the Data Technology setting
  • Problem-solving: ability to see data trends and suggest potential solutions that create value, efficiencies, or reduce overall impact on the IT production environment
  • Time management: ability to work on large projects with multiple data streams and deadlines
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Critical, analytical, and quantitative thinking
  • Excellent organizational and planning skills

Preferred Qualifications

  • Direct work experience in a Data Analysis or Data Engineering role
  • Experience with large data-driven projects where data is being obtained from different systems
  • Technical experience that includes data modeling is a plus
  • ITIL V2 or V3 Certified
  • Kepner-Tregoe Certified

Education Requirements

Bachelor's degree in Data Science, Computer Science, Information Systems, Programming, Electrical or Computer Engineering, or an equivalent field of study, or possibly equivalent work experience.
